Overview
Welcome to the Town of Ashland's Parks and Recreation Department! As the “Center of the Universe,” Ashland offers a variety of unique and engaging parks, trails, and recreational opportunities to reach a diverse community of citizens and visitors. Whether it’s jumping into Carter Park Pool, watching passing trains on Railside Trail, or taking a nature walk in DeJarnette Park, Ashland has a park or program for you!
What We Offer
The Town currently maintains four parks and numerous trails. These parks include a variety of seasonal activities such as a swimming pool, playground equipment, fishing pond, skate park, basketball courts, and picnic shelters.

Our Parks and Facilities are Tobacco Free.
The Parks & Recreation Department is committed to healthy, safe, and welcoming parks that improve the well-being of our citizens. That's why we've partnered with the Virginia Foundation for Healthy Youth's "Share the Air" campaign to designate our parks and trails as tobacco and e-cigarette free.
